Read moreThe Lookout Cafe is a great place to stop for a bite to eat and a drink while visiting Holkham Beach. It has a simple offering of cakes, pasties, filter coffee, and soups, but the food is all of high quality.
The cafe is located in a beautiful spot overlooking the nature reserve, and it has plenty of outdoor seating, making it the perfect place to enjoy a sunny day. There is also a limited amount of indoor seating, which is ideal for colder or wet days.
The staff at The Lookout Cafe are very friendly and helpful, pointing out where to get trays, or quickly opening a second till when one was slowed down by a husband checking something with his wife.
The cafe also sells dog treats and has a central water fountain with inbuilt dog bowls, making it a great place to visit with your furry friend.
The only downside to The Lookout Cafe is that it is quite expensive. However, the prices are reflective of the convenient location. This remoteness possibly also is the reason for limited food selection.
